Comprehending SEAT Replacement Car Keys
SEAT, a popular car manufacturer in Europe, produces a wide range of vehicles equipped with different kinds of keys. Depending upon the model, keys can range from conventional mechanical keys to advanced remote-controlled or wise keys. Understanding how to replace these keys correctly can conserve owners both money and time.

Factors for Replacement
There are various factors why a SEAT car key might need to be replaced:
- Loss or Theft: Keys can easily be lost or taken.
- Damage: Keys can break or break due to routine usage.
- Breakdown: Key fobs may quit working due to battery failure or internal damage.
- Programming Issues: Sometimes, the key might lose its alignment with the car's computer system, necessitating reprogramming or total replacement.
Replacement Process
Replacing a SEAT car key includes several actions. Here is a breakdown of the procedure:
1. Recognize the Key Type
Understanding which type of key you require to change is crucial. The process varies for traditional keys versus clever keys.
2. Gather Necessary Documents
Before initiating the replacement procedure, gather the following documents:
- Vehicle registration file
- Proof of identity (Driver's license or passport)
- Proof of ownership (Purchase receipt or title deed)
3. Contact SEAT Dealer or Automaker
The next step is to contact your local SEAT dealership or licensed service center. They can provide you with guidance regarding the specifics of your car model.
4. Key Programming
Key programming is an important part of the replacement procedure. For G28 Car Keys with transponder keys or clever keys, the brand-new key should be configured to sync with the vehicle's computer system. Numerous car dealerships charge extra for this service.
5. Purchasing a New Key
Upon verification of requirements and costs, you can go ahead and buy a brand-new key.
Cost Breakdown
The costs connected with changing a SEAT car key can differ widely based on the kind of key, the model of the automobile, and the service provider. Below is a basic cost quote.
Key Type
Estimated Cost Range
Notes
Conventional Key
₤ 50 – ₤ 150
Easy cut, no programming required
Transponder Key
₤ 150 – ₤ 250
Includes standard programming
Remote Key Fob
₤ 200 – ₤ 400
Programming typically required
Smart Key
₤ 300 – ₤ 600
Advanced programming included

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: Can I change my SEAT key without going to a dealer?
A1: While it is possible to get keys made at locksmith professionals, a dealer is advised for programming transponder and wise keys.
Q2: What if my key is damaged but still works?
A2: If your key is operational but revealing indications of wear, think about changing it to avoid future problems.
Q3: How long does it require to get a replacement key?
A3: Depending on the key type and dealership, it can take anywhere from a couple of hours to numerous days.
Q4: Is it possible to get a duplicate key for my SEAT?
A4: Yes, you can get duplicates for most key types offered you have the original key and the needed files.
Q5: Can clever keys be cloned?
A5: Yes, in some cases, but this needs a special gadget and might not be totally legal depending on local guidelines.
Q6: What should I do if I lose my only key?
A6: If you lose your only key, contact a dealership or licensed locksmith professional instantly for assistance. They can assist set a new key based on your VIN number.
